Solution for -3y-2+5y-8=10 equation:


Simplifying
-3y + -2 + 5y + -8 = 10

Reorder the terms:
-2 + -8 + -3y + 5y = 10

Combine like terms: -2 + -8 = -10
-10 + -3y + 5y = 10

Combine like terms: -3y + 5y = 2y
-10 + 2y = 10

Solving
-10 + 2y = 10

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'10' to each side of the equation.
-10 + 10 + 2y = 10 + 10

Combine like terms: -10 + 10 = 0
0 + 2y = 10 + 10
2y = 10 + 10

Combine like terms: 10 + 10 = 20
2y = 20

Divide each side by '2'.
y = 10

Simplifying
y = 10
